A PSA nitrogen generator produces nitrogen through a process that starts when compressed air is passed through a combination of filters to remove oil and moisture, then the purified air is directed to adsorption vessels that contain carbon molecular sieve. help screen for prostate cancer. Typically, a PSA level above 4 on lab results is flagged as “abnormal,” prompting further evaluation. However, even PSA numbers below 4 can be concerning if they’re rapidly increasing. That’s why PSA tests are done annually: to monitor trends over time....
